Scientists are discovering that restraining specific dietary nutrients can easily suppress cancer cells, too.Qing Xu, a biologist in the NIEHS Metabolism, Genes, and Environment Team, is actually lead author on a paper, published Aug. 7 in Nature Communications. Xu and her co-authors stated that the extraction of methionine-- some of the vital amino acids, or building blocks, of healthy proteins-- coming from tissue development media hinders growth expansion and metastasis in liver cancer cells cells.The system includes the professional regulatory authority of liver genes, referred to as hepatocyte atomic element 4alpha (HNF4alpha), as well as methionine metabolism.Dissecting cancer progressionMethionine has sulfur as well as is actually discovered in pork, fish, and dairy products. The body breaks down half of all nutritional methionine in the liver, a metabolic organ. The method is generally known as sulfur amino acid (SAA) metabolism.Xu pointed out that the amount of essential enzymes involved in SAA metabolism is actually decreased in individual liver tumors, particularly hepatocellular cancer (HCC), the absolute most usual and also dangerous form of liver cancer. She mentioned the group found that in liver cancer cells, SAA metabolic process resolved through HNF4alpha establishes their sensitiveness to cell fatality coming from methionine constraint.' The epithelial cells of the liver are highly concentrated cells. They must change into unspecialized cells, called mesenchymal tissues, for liver cysts to form,' Xu mentioned. 'HNF4alpha commonly inhibits this transformation, but when its own degrees drop, it can easily not stop the progress of cancer.' He revealed that researchers name this mobile cancer transformation the epithelial-mesenchymal shift (EMERGENCY MEDICAL TECHNICIAN). Some liver cancer cells tissue collections will definitely possess HNF4alpha, he said, while others will not." People with liver cancers cells that are HNF4alpha beneficial possess the very best opportunity of responding to methionine constraint, but those that do not have HNF4alpha will certainly not benefit in any way," Shats said.Xiaoling Li, Ph.D., co-corresponding author and head of the study team, mentioned the research study set up a link in between HNF4alpha and SAA metabolic rate in liver cancer. While epithelial liver cancer cells with very high levels of HNF4alpha are sensitive to methionine limitation, mesenchymal cells possess reduced degrees of the owner regulatory authority as well as are actually resistant to methionine constraint.' Methionine restriction has actually been shown to copy calorie stipulation in relations to anti-aging in some organisms,' Li said. 'Our experts intend to continue studying the mechanism behind it.'
